Previous thread titles: "Thinking of Nelson Mandela"

Summary of events:
  • 8 June: Nelson Mandela was admitted to hospital with a serious lung infection. (Source: BBC)
  • 23 June: Jacob Zuma announced that Nelson Mandela was critically ill. (Source: BBC)
  • 29 June: Barack Obama visits South Africa. (Source: Al Jazeera and BBC)
  • 18 July: Nelson Mandela reaches 95th birthday with optimistic news from Zuma. (Source: BBC)
Nelson Mandela has been admitted to hospital for, as far as I know, the third time this year: I must come clear that am starting to worry for his health, given that it is a recurrence of a lung infection. I am hopeful that Nelson Mandela will recover, because he has done so much for freedom in South Africa, even though there are noticeable problems in the country right now, but regrettably the reality of his health in sinking in.
